Today we’d like to introduce you to Rich Brown

Hi Rich, please kick things off for us with an introduction to yourself and your story.
I started in 1994. I had a couple of years of art school and not quite sure what direction I was going. I then saw an artist drawing caricatures at a marketplace in Columbus, Ohio, and decided to be a great avenue for me. I received some drawing tips from the artist and began my mission of learning how to draw caricatures. After about six months of intense training, I started to draw caricatures at parties for a living. I moved to Tampa soon after in the fall of 1994, and I’ve been in the Tampa Bay area ever since. I started richcaricatures.com in Tampa 27 years ago and we’re still going strong. I have a team of about a dozen artists all over Florida entertaining at private and corporate events. All of our artists are members of ISCA (International Society of Caricaturists). A worldwide organization of professional artists that supports continued education etc. All of our artists have a minimum of 20 years of caricature experience. Over the course of 27 years, we have entertained hundreds and hundreds of clients, corporate and private. A few of them include all of the Tampa Bay professional sports teams, Delta Airlines, Raymond James Financial, Lockheed Martin and on and on.

Alright, so let’s switch gears a bit and talk business. What should we know about your work?
Our specialty is drawing traditional and digital caricatures by the hour at corporate and private parties. We draw approximately 12 to 14 black and white traditional drawings per hour on 11 x 14 paper. Each drawing is given to the guest in a clear plastic sleeve. Our digital Caricatures are drawn on a new iPad Pro. The drawings are also projected onto a 32” inch television monitor where guests can watch everyone’s drawing evolve in real-time. Each full color 4 x 6 drawing is printed on-site and is given to the guest in a clear plastic sleeve or lanyard. Each drawing can be downloaded by the guest on our website. All of the drawings can also be put on a jump drive for the client at the end of the event.
